Description
In commenting on a paper by Moharil (J. Phys. D.: 14:1677 (1981)) the claim made in that paper that the proposed method of analysing thermoluminescent isothermal decay curves for general order kinetics is more accurate than other methods since it is not dependent on the trap depth, is disputed. In a reply the original author maintains that his claim is not that the experimental accuracy of the suggested method is an improvement but that the advantage lies in not using trap depth values.
